I was just changing the coil on a customers Stihl MS250 and noticed the cylinder is clearly stamped with the Stihl logo, the word "Stihl" with the copyright logo after it, and 1122. Why would an MS250 cylinder be stamped 1122?? I thought that was to identify 066/660 and 064 saws and parts.
